Claims
- 1. An apparatus for effecting delivery of an injectable product, comprising:
- a housing;
- a container secured to said housing and including an inner chamber for containing the injectable product, a piston, and an exit, the injectable product contained between said piston and said exit;
- a drive stem disposed in said housing and being in engagement with said piston, wherein a length of axial movement of said drive stem with respect to said housing between a pre-injection position and a post-injection position defines a stroke length of said drive stem;
- means for maintaining said drive stem in engagement with said piston by preventing axial retraction of said drive stem away from said piston;
- a manually adjustable dosage metering mechanism comprising a nut rotatably engaging said drive stem and a dial assembly rotatably engageable and axially engageable with said nut, said dosage metering mechanism disposed in said housing and having an initial axial position, wherein the stroke length is zero, and a dose setting axial position corresponding to a selectively adjustable positive stroke length, said dosage metering mechanism movable between said initial axial position and said dose setting axial position by movement of said dial assembly by a user;
- means coupled to said dosage metering mechanism for preventing the movement of said dosage metering mechanism from said initial axial position to said dose setting axial position until said dosage metering mechanism has been set to a radial zero dose position;
- a clutching mechanism operatively disposed between said nut and said dial assembly, said clutching mechanism comprising first and second clutch surfaces respectively disposed on said nut and said dial assembly, disengagement of said clutch surfaces rotatably disengaging said nut and said dial assembly in said initial axial position and engagement of said clutch surfaces engaging said nut and said dial assembly in said dose setting axial position whereby rotation of said dial assembly in said dose setting axial position repositions said nut with respect to said drive stem; and
- wherein axial advancement of said dosage metering mechanism from a dose setting axial position and a positive dose radial position, towards said container to said initial position drives said drive stem from said pre-injection position to said post-injection position.
- 2. The apparatus of claim 1 further comprising
- means in said housing for causing an audible clicking noise to be made upon axially advancing said drive assembly from said pre-injection position to said post-injection position, said means for causing noise providing an audible indication to a user that a complete dosage has been delivered.
- 3.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ein said clutching mechanism comprises a first spline disposed on said nut and a second spline disposed on said dial assembly, said splines positioned whereby said first spline is rotatably engaged with said second spline in said dose setting axial position and said splines are rotatably disengaged in said initial axial position.
